Kayne (KBDC) earnings analysis | profitability metrics and sector trends remain in focus. Kayne Anderson BDC Inc. (KBDC)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$0.49, ex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.4121 by 18.9%. Revenue figures were not disclosed. The stock rose $0.14 following the announcement, suggesting a tempered positive response to the earnings beat.

The quarter’s performance was primarily driven by strong investment income from KBDC’s diversified portfolio of middle-market loans. While the company did not break out revenue or net investment income, the EPS beat indicates solid underwriting and consistent interest income. As a business development company, KBDC’s earnings are heavily influenced by the credit quality of its portfolio companies and the floating-rate nature of its debt investments. The 18.9% surprise suggests either lower-than-expected credit losses or higher-than-projected income from prepayment fees and dividend income. Operating expenses likely remained managed, supporting net margins. The BDC sector continues to benefit from elevated base rates, though the pace of future net asset value (NAV) growth may depend on portfolio valuations and new origination activity. Without a revenue figure, investors must focus on net investment income per share and NAV trends to gauge underlying business health.

KBDC did not provide formal guidance for the upcoming quarters, which is common for BDCs that rely on market conditions for deal flow. Management may emphasize stable dividend coverage and a defensive portfolio posture amid uncertainty about interest rate cuts. The company could continue to target investments in senior secured loans with floating coupons to mitigate duration risk. Growth expectations hinge on deal origination in the middle market, where competition from private credit funds persists. KBDC’s strategic priorities likely include maintaining a high level of portfolio diversification and managing non-accruals. Potential risk factors include a slowdown in the economy that could pressure borrower cash flows, though the existing credit quality appears supportive. Investors should watch for any changes in the dividend payout ratio or guidance on NAV per share in future filings.

Shares rose $0.14 after the report, a relatively muted reaction given the sizable EPS beat. This may reflect the lack of revenue details and the already elevated valuation of many BDCs. Analysts are likely to note the positive earnings surprise but will seek more color on the composition of income and portfolio quality. Some may view the stock as fairly valued given the current yield environment. Key items to watch in the coming quarters include the net investment income trend, non-accrual levels, and any acquisitions or new portfolio additions. The company’s ability to sustain or grow its dividend will be a focal point for income-oriented investors.
